Comprehending Car Wrapping


Vehicle wraps are an innovative way to personalize and protect your vehicle's exterior. These covers are made from vinyl film that are engineered to stick to the exterior of your auto, providing both a aesthetic upgrade and a coating of defense against the elements. The method involves covering the complete vehicle or chosen parts, allowing for a full transformation without the permanence of a paint job.


In Colorado Springs, the demand of vehicle wraps has surged as more car owners seek ways to make a statement on the road. Car wraps can showcase vibrant colors, detailed designs, or even business logos, making them an great choice for personal autos as well as commercial vehicles. With the appropriate care, these covers can persist for a number of years, preserving both the appearance and the base paint.


Comprehending how vinyl wraps work is essential for those considering this choice. The vinyl is put on using heat and force, ensuring a snug fit around contours and curves. This method of application not only enhances the vehicle's appearance but also safeguards the original paint from UV rays, scratches, and other potential deterioration while bringing a distinctive style to your vehicle.


Cleaning and Maintenance Tips


To keep your vehicle vinyl cover appearing fresh and lively, consistent washing is important. Use a mild detergent and H2O mix to clean your wrap, not using harsh substances that can damage the material. A gentle pad or microfiber is ideal for clearing contaminants without scratching the finish. Wash off well to ensure no soap residue is left, which can reduce the look of your wrap as time goes by.


It is necessary to not use automatic car washes that use scrubbing devices, as these can cause significant damage and tear on the wrap. Rather, opt for a contactless car cleaning service if you want to save time. If you prefer to hand wash your automobile, ensure that you wipe it properly with a new soft cloth to prevent water spots and marks from developing. This diligent process to washing will help support the integrity of the wrap.

Protecting Your Vehicle Wrap from Harm


To ensure the longevity of your vehicle wrap, it is important to shield it from potential damage caused by the elements. Ultraviolet rays from the sun can lead to color loss and deterioration of the colors over time. If you reside in an area like Colorado Springs, where sunlight can be intense, consider parking your vehicle in shaded areas or using a car cover when not in use. Additionally, applying a protective coat can provide an extra layer against ultraviolet damage and the elements.


Another common threat to vehicle wraps is physical damage from everyday use. Road debris, branches, and even small accidents can lead to marks or rips in the vinyl wrap. To minimize this risk, try to avoid driving in areas where you might encounter gravel or construction sites. Being careful of how close you park to other vehicles can also prevent unwanted scuffs or damage from neighboring doors.


Maintaining your vehicle wrap correctly is essential for its maintenance. Use a gentle soap with water and avoid harsh materials that can scratch the surface. When washing, opt for a soft cloth and avoid automatic car washes that use rough brushes. This will help maintain your car wrap looking fresh and vibrant while preventing damage that could jeopardize its integrity over time. Regularly assessing the wrap for signs of wear can help you catch issues early and extend its lifespan.

Signs The Signs That Your Wrap Demands Replacement


The of the most obvious signs that your vehicle wrap demands replacement is clear fading. If the vibrant colors of your wrap has dulled significantly from sun exposure or extreme weather conditions, it can influence the overall look of the vehicle. In places like Colorado Springs, where the sun can be strong, the probability of color fading grows. If the vehicle wrap has lost its vividness and no longer reflects the image that you want to project, it may be time for a fresh car wrap.


A further critical indicator is the presence of cracks or peeling in the vinyl. Over time, vehicle wraps can suffer from damage, leading to cracks that compromise the strength of the vinyl. If one start to see edges lifting or areas where the vinyl is not adhering to the vehicle, it can allow dirt and moisture to pass underneath, causing further harm. In such cases, replacing the wrap not only restores the appearance but also protects the underlying paint from potential harm.


Finally, if you notice that your wrap is becoming increasingly difficult to clean, this can signal that it has reached the end of its lifespan. A vehicle wrap should be easy to maintain, but an old or worn-out wrap can accumulate dirt and grime, making it hard to achieve a fresh appearance. If you are often struggling to keep the wrap looking presentable, consider getting a replacement vehicle wrap to maintain the business-like look of your car in Colorado Springs.
